Torres for her many years 6of public service and extraordinary accomplishments; and 7 WHEREAS, Lena Randazzo Torres is the daughter of the late Petrina Livaccari and 8Sam Randazzo who were both descendants of Palermo, Italy; and 9 WHEREAS, she is a graduate of Maumus High School and a graduate of Soule' 10Business College; and 11 WHEREAS, she was a loving and devoted wife to the love of her life, the late 12Sidney D. Torres, is a committed mother and cherished grandmother, great-grandmother, 13relative, and friend whose love of family and friends is of the utmost importance in her life; 14and 15 WHEREAS, her long and illustrious career in public service has spanned over 16seventy years, beginning and ending in the St. Bernard Clerk of Court's Office from 1940 17to 1946, moving to the Louisiana County Agricultural Extension Division from 1946 to 181956, becoming Chief Deputy Clerk of Court from 1956 to 1988, and being appointed Clerk 19of Court upon the death of her husband and Clerk of Court Sidney D. Torres Jr.; and 20 WHEREAS, she was elected Clerk of Court for St. Bernard Parish in 1988, was 21reelected five times, and served until her retirement in 2012; and Page 1 of 4 HLS 19RS-3729 ORIGINAL HR NO. 296 1 WHEREAS, Lena is an exemplary and highly admired citizen of Louisiana who has 2worked tirelessly on a multitude of business, civic, community, political, and religious 3causes throughout her life; and 4 WHEREAS, she has been active and involved in numerous organizations: the 5St. Bernard Society for Crippled Children, St. Bernard Business and Professional Women's 6Club (Charter Member), St. Bernard Battered Women's Association, Louisiana Clerks of 7Court Association, National Association of County Recorders, Election Officials and Clerks, 8International Association of Clerks, Recorders, Elected Officials and Treasurers, Suburban 9Woman's Club, Arabi Lions Women's Auxiliary, Chalmette Medical Center Auxiliary, Serra 10Club of St. Bernard (Charter Member), American Association of Retired Persons, 11Kiwanis Club, The Elenian Club, Canary Island Descendants Association, Los Islenos 12Cultural & Heritage Society, and the St. Bernard Parish Retired Teachers Association; and 13 WHEREAS, her honors and awards are vast and include receiving the Alliance for 14Good Government Past President's Award, Legislator of the Year in 1989, the Appreciation 15Award from Chalmette Strutters in 1994, the Strength in Age Award from Louisiana State 16University Medical Center in 1998, the Community Involvement Award for 1998-1999, 17Chamber of Commerce C.
